This Charming 150 year old Historical Victorian flat is located 1 block from the beach and 3 blocks from Washington Square! Private deck included along with wrap around communal front porch. Beautiful traditional decor adds to the old world feel of the lovely Cape May Shore. Local activities are almost all within walking distance!!

About the area
Cape May
Located near the beach, this apartment is in Cape May Historic District, a neighbourhood in Cape May. Washington Street Mall and Wildwood Boardwalk are worth checking out if shopping is on the agenda, while those wishing to experience the area's natural beauty can explore Cape May Beach and Sunset Beach. Looking to enjoy an event or a game while in town? See what's happening at Wildwood Crest Tennis Center or Stone Harbor Tennis Center - 96th St. Discover the area's water adventures with jet skiing and kayaking nearby, or enjoy the great outdoors with hiking and cycling.

We arrived at this home to find easy push button access, and we didn't have much of a problem with the on street parking. Guests were myself, my daughter and my dog. The back yard had a nice grassy area for him. The home is a quirky old Victorian, and as my daughter and I are used to living in old houses, we found the jigs, jogs, and steps very charming. The pictures and decorating was cozy, with several antiques and old picture frames. The kitchen was well-equipped and clean, except no extra trash bags. The recycling instructions and instructions for the TV were very clear. The apartment was relatively soundproofed, we could hear footsteps occasionally, but no conversation or TVs, which we appreciated, as I was afraid that my dog would bark, but it was quiet, despite having people in the entire house. We appreciate that linens and towels were provided, as many landlords don't provide them any more. The air conditioners and TV worked fine. One of my favorite places was the back porch, totally enclosed, so that my dog could be out there with us, and I could leave the door open at night with the screen hooked, and it was lovely with the ceiling fan on and the air conditioning off. The neighborhood is very pleasant for walks, beach chairs and floats are available, which was nice. Just three suggestions: A table lamp in the living room, so we didn't have to use the overhead light all the time. A thicker curtain in the back bathroom, and repair the outlet under the air conditioner
